Fulham remain in the bottom three but suddenly there seems hope that survival can be achieved. They’re just two points behind fourth-bottom Brighton but, notably, the Cottagers have two games in hand over the Seagulls.
From looking pushovers, Fulham are suddenly very hard to beat. Their only loss since November 22 came at Manchester City and even then that 2-0 defeat was hardly a disgrace. The problem is, Fulham are still struggling to win games. In fact, they’re now bona fide draw specialists having had stalemates in their last five Premier League outings.
That run includes draws against Liverpool (home) and Spurs (away) so they’re providing stern opposition to the top teams which bodes well for the visit of Chelsea.
The Blues have been tough opponents for them though. In fact, they’ve lost the last five Premier League games against their local rivals and not beaten them anywhere since March 2006. We feel the Cottagers will show their usual game spirit in this west London derby but ultimately be outgunned.
Last Fulham line-up: Areola, Tete, Andersen, Adarabioyo, Robinson, Aina, Loftus-Cheek, Reed, Zambo, Decordova-Reid, Cavaleiro.
Club captain Tom Cairney has an issue with his knee and could be joined on the sidelines by Aleksandar Mitrovic, who had a slight problem in the FA Cup win at QPR but has returned to training.
The injury list looks shorter with Kenny Tete, Terence Kongolo and Josh Onomah back, although Mario Lemina is not expected to feature because of an unspecified problem.
From a Chelsea point of view, they haven’t lost to Fulham in all competitions in 19 games. But it’s recent form, not historical, that will be of most concern to Chelsea.
From looking like a side that could take their turn at the top of the Premier League’s ever-changing summit, the Blues are suddenly down in ninth place. Talk of Chelsea challenging for the title has faded away following a run of four defeats in six league games.
To be fair, though, the first three came in tough visits to Everton, Wolves and Arsenal, while losing at home to Manchester City is no disgrace in their current mood. In between, the Blues secured a convincing 3-0 success versus West Ham and drew 1-1 with Aston Villa. Saturday’s 4-0 triumph over Morecambe was a welcome fillip, especially with Mason Mount, Timo Werner, Callum Hudson-Odoi and Kai Havertz grabbing the goals.
Lampard has consistently spoken about how youthful his expensively-assembled squad is and that consistency will only come with experience. He reiterated: “We have a lot of young players with a lot of potential, who are coming through and of a young age.
“But the players at the top of the Premier League are scoring week on week and winning year on year, and at the ages of 27, 28, and 29 are very established. “They produce week on week, with big numbers. Players at that stage expect to be producing at those sorts of levels.
“So, for us there’s work to be done to get to the levels where hopefully we can jump to challenge those teams.”
Chelsea owner Roman Abramovich isn’t known for his patience, though, so this is the kind of game where Lampard can ill-afford another slip-up. The stats show Fulham can be vulnerable early on in each half, showing a 1-7 deficit in the opening quarter of an hour of matches and 0-6 in the first 15 minutes after the break.
Last Chelsea line-up: Kepa, Rudiger, Zouma, Azpilicueta, Emerson, Mount, Hudson-Odoi, Ziyech, Gilmour, Havertz, Werner.
Chelsea defenders Reece James and Andreas Christensen will return to contention. James is back in training after a thigh injury, while Christensen has shaken off a knee issue.
Midfielder N’Golo Kante is set to return to training after a hamstring problem but will still miss the match through suspension.
